Preparation
- STEP 1 OF 4
Mash the pumpkin with a fork and then add the ingredients. The well-squeezed bread, the egg, salt, nutmeg, and aromatic herbs.
- STEP 2 OF 4
Give it an initial mix and then start incorporating the chickpea flour (or breadcrumbs) until the mixture is workable by hand. At this point, take a small amount of the mixture.
- STEP 3 OF 4
Create a hole in the center to place the cheese and close it up to form the meatball. Roll them in the coating before placing them on a baking tray lined with parchment paper and greased with a bit of seed oil.
- STEP 4 OF 4
Bake at 200 degrees for about 15/20 minutes, turning them halfway through cooking.

More information
How did I cook the pumpkin? Before using it, I cut it into cubes and baked it at 180 with ventilation for about 15 minutes. It will become nice and soft, and you can mash it with a fork!
